  Lot 241
 

A PORTRAIT OF A RULER North India, late 19th century  Opaque pigments heightened with silver and gold on paper, in a palace interior the heavily bejewelled ruler seated on a silver throne, portrayed with a halo and holding a pearl and emerald-encrusted sarpech (turban ornament), the attendant in front of him holding his hands tight together as a sign of respect and the three attendants behind him with a fly-whisk, a peacock's feather fan and a gilt baton, within black, blue, white and ochre yellow rules, 27.2cm x 21.3cm.
